Production of neutron-rich heavy residues and the freeze-out temperature in the fragmentation of relativistic 238U projectiles determined by the isospin thermometer

Isotope yields of heavy residues produced in collisions of U-238 with lead at 1 A GeV show indications for a simultaneous break-up process. From the average N-over-Z ratio of the final residues up to Z = 70, the average limiting temperature of the break-up configuration at freeze out was determined to T approximate to 5 MeV using the isospin-thermometer method. Consequences for the understanding of other phenomena in highly excited nuclear systems are discussed. (C) 2002 Elsevier Science B.V. All rights reserved.
